The Buffalo Wallow Cabin is named after the fascinating bowl like depressions made by wallowing herds of bison as they roll on the ground in a dust bath. Wallows still dot the prairie today and play an important role in the ecosystem. Nestled at the foothills of the Wichita Mountains, The Lazy Buffalo has 13 uniquely themed Cabins. Just 3 miles from the refuge entrance, the Wichita Mountains Wildlife Refuge preserves 59,000 acres of mixed prairie grass, ancient mountains, lakes, and streams. Herds of bison, longhorn, and elk can be seen roaming free and there's endless recreations opportunities such as fishing, bird watching, mountain biking, hiking, rock climbing, and kayaking. WICHITA MOUNTAINS WILDLIFE REFUGE – 3 miles
The Wildlife refuge spans 59000 acres and home to free range buffalo, longhorn cattle, and other species. Stop at the Visitor Center for a wealth of information on all the Refuge attractions including the Holy City, Quanah Parker Lake, parallel forest, forty-foot hole, and Charon’s garden trail.

FORT SILL – 20 minutes
Fort Sill is the last remaining active military post that was built during the Indian war and is home to the US Army's Field Artillery. The prominent Native American leader of the Chiricahua Apache, Geronimo, is buried at the Fort Sill Cemetery.
